[Photo] Demolition of Sarangjeil Church Fails
The third eviction enforcement at Seongbuk-gu Sarang Jeil Church was halted after about 7 hours. According to the police on the 26th, approximately 570 enforcement personnel from the Seoul Northern District Court attempted a forced eviction of the church facilities starting around 1 a.m., but withdrew around 8:30 a.m. due to resistance from the congregants. The photo shows the alley leading to Sarang Jeil Church on that day. / Reporter Mun Honam munonam@
